National Characters Displayed as Question Marks when Exported as CSV Through Case Management Filter
(Doc ID 2472741.1)
Last updated on MAY 25, 2023
Applies to:
Oracle Enterprise Data Quality - Version 12.1.3.0.0 and laterOracle Enterprise Data Quality on Marketplace - Version 12.2.1.4.3 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
When data containing National characters (like Chinese, Japanese, etc.) is exported from the Case Management (CM) filter view to a CSV file or Excel file, the characters are replaced by the question mark character (?).
